week one we'll see if they're out there on Thursday if they're not then it's much likelier that week three is the soonest possible return date for those two players Jake Moody the fort Anders kicker is your NFC offensive uh special teams player of the week I would say that maybe he qualified for an offensive player as well since he scored 20 of the 49ers 32 points against the Jets six field goals and two extra points two of those six field goals for Jake Moody came from over 50 yards so he became the first kicker in 49ers history to do that in one game six field goals including two over 50 for Jake Moody congratulations to him looks like that third round pick the 49ers used on a kicker was a smart decision he was good last year and we reported it over training camp Jake movy was looking
